Transaction 5869676883ddf4fdc52c810a1b2b693d8517df321dd51fc1138fbda230b674ce
1 Input
1 Output
-
5869676883ddf4fdc52c810a1b2b693d8517df321dd51fc1138fbda230b674ce:0
- value
- 400448
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02584aafdb80b74fecc499a000b063027844cebf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Q816krJ1xtCBJUP3XKW14WSsYmqSXDg